### Step 6 — Health checks behind the Marrow LB

The Marrow load balancer probes each Quillstack node at `/healthz` every five seconds and ejects a node after three consecutive failures, so make the endpoint cheap: it must not touch the database or the Fennick cache. Set `HEALTHZ_DEEP_CHECK=false` in production; deep checks belong on the internal `/readyz` path only. Probes are mutually authenticated to stop spoofed ejections during deploys, and the shared probe credential goes in the env file on the line below.

vault entry, yahif-yajep: COURIER_KEY29=b802bdf8034096b65a51c6ba5abe2

### Step 4: Configure the diff service

Largediff splits files over 50 MB into chunked hunks rendered lazily, so the worker needs generous memory: set `CHUNK_WORKER_MEM=2048` and `MAX_HUNK_CACHE=500` before first boot. Do not lower `CHUNK_WORKER_MEM` on the Veldmore cluster — earlier maintainers tried and the renderer silently truncated diffs, which caused a bad merge. Verify `STORAGE_BACKEND=blobvault` matches the bucket region. The worker authenticates to the blob store with a service credential, which you should add on the following line.

sealed setting: ARCHIVE_KEY3=8d0

## Snapshrink CLI — Environments

Snapshrink, our batch image-resizing CLI, targets three environments: sandbox, staging, and production. Each environment has isolated credentials, separate object stores, and distinct concurrency ceilings. No environment shares network paths with another, and promotion requires a signed manifest. For your review, the production environment's effective configuration values are reproduced below.

service settings:
novath:
  pin: 1396
  tenant: pelys
  seal: seal_ccc035e1
  metrics_host: metrics.novath.qorvelworks.test
  standby_team: fraeth
  escalation: drueth-zorok
  nonce: 61d508

Subject: Ownership change — websocket reconnect bug

Team,

Quick note ahead of the sync: the long-standing reconnect bug in the Pondskater gateway (clients stuck in a retry loop after idle timeout) is moving off the platform backlog. With Hollis rotating to the Briarline launch, this issue now has a new owner who will present a fix plan at Thursday's sync. The new owner's full name follows.

named custodian: Brivan Eliath Quenox Frador